## Support

The Vexam proctoring queue processes session-review jobs from the Hollowbrook exam platform. If the queue depth alarm fires, check the worker pool in the Vexam dashboard first; stalled workers are the usual cause. Restart instructions are in the runbook under queue-recovery. Do not purge the queue without sign-off, as jobs represent live exam sessions. For unresolved incidents or anything affecting active exams, contact the proctoring platform team at the address below.

alerts address for yajof-kahog: eliax@qirvanlabs.corp

## Who owns the lag alarm

Heads up: the read-replica lag alarm for Tidepool can get noisy right around release cutover, since the migration step briefly stalls replay. That's expected for up to five minutes — don't hold the release for it. If it stays red past that, or you want the threshold tweaked before a big ship, go straight to the owner below.

named custodian: Brivan Eliath Quenox Frador

### Step 4: Enable SQL Lint Enforcement

Before cutting the Quillbarrow 3.2 release, switch the SQL linter from warn mode to enforce mode. Every `.sql` file under the migrations directory must now pass the Fennelgate rule set: no unqualified column references, explicit transaction boundaries, and mandatory rollback scripts. Run the full lint pass locally first, because CI will hard-fail on any violation and block the release branch. Once the repository is clean, apply the enforcement configuration shown below.

settings of fafog-haduf:
ZORIX_PIN=4648
ZORIX_METRICS_HOST=metrics.zorix.paliqsys.corp
ZORIX_LOG_LEVEL=info
ZORIX_TENANT=druix

Ticket: Config drift on Squatterhawk scanner nodes

The Squatterhawk typo-squatting scanner in the Delmont cluster has drifted from the baseline. Two worker nodes are running an older ruleset-refresh interval and a mismatched registry mirror list, which explains the inconsistent detections reported this morning. On-call should reconcile the nodes against the source-of-truth manifest and restart the watcher processes. No data loss expected. For reference, the intended baseline configuration is as follows.

service settings:
PRAIX_LOG_LEVEL=error
PRAIX_METRICS_HOST=metrics.praix.qorvelcorp.corp
PRAIX_POOL_SIZE=16